Source: CoinGlass What futures open interest means for XRP Open interest in futures markets represents the total value of outstanding derivative contracts that have not yet been settled or closed. In other words, it tracks the number of active long and short positions in the market at any given time. YieldMax, a firm specializing in exchange-traded funds (ETFs), has filed to launch a novel yield-bearing ETF based on shares of Michael Saylor’s Bitcoin (BTC) holding company, MicroStrategy. According to a Dec. 7 filing with the U. S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), the proposed ETF, named Option Income Strategy ETF, is scheduled for a 2024 release and will trade under the ticker MSTY. This ETF employs a “synthetic covered call” strategy, which involves a combination of buying call options and selling put options to generate income. This income is then planned to be distributed monthly to MSTY ETF holders. Interestingly, the ETF will not hold any spot MicroStrategy shares but will solely focus on trading MSTR derivatives . To mitigate risks, the fund will cap its monthly gains from call options at 15%.
